POLICE have found a body in the search for missing Taunton man Scott McCafferty.

Officers have been trawling the River Tone for the past few weeks in the search for Scott, and have today confirmed they found a body of a man at midday today near Ruishton.

Specialist police divers were bought in by Avon and Somerset Police after Scott was first reported missing one month ago on January 4, and have searched from French Weir towards Ruishton, including Taunton town centre.

Police divers have already trawled a stretch of the River Tone from French Weir towards the town centre.

Scott's family has been informed of the find.

A spokesman from Avon and Somerset Police said: "The body of a man has been found during the search for missing Scott McCafferty.

"Mr McCafferty, 33, was reported missing on 4 January from the Taunton area.

"The body of a man was recovered from the River Tone near Ruishton at approximately 12pm today.

"While formal identification is yet to be carried out, Mr McCafferty’s family has been informed.

"The death is not being treated as suspicious and we are now carrying out enquiries on behalf of the coroner."
